World Travel Awards winners unveiled in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am

World Travel Awards winners unveiled in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am

The finest travel brands from across Asia and Oceania have been unveiled at a red carpet Gala Ceremony in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am. The industry elite travelled from across the region to the fascinating metropolis for the World Travel Awards (WTA) Asia & Oceania Gala Ceremony 2023 to find out who amongst them had been crowned best of the best.

Last Few Days to Catch the Operafest Lisboa

Last Few Days to Catch the Operafest Lisboa

This is the last opportunity to catch the 4th edition of Operafest Lisboa, which finishes on September 9th and promises visitors opera like never before. Led by soprano Catarina Molder and produced by Ópera do Castelo, the almost month-long festival will be held at Lisbon's idyllic Garden of Museu Nacional de Arte Antiga overlooking the River Tagus.
